Evaluation of Subjective Ratings on a New Sound Processor and Compatible Products
November 15, 2016 updated by: Cochlear
Clinical study designed to collect user feedback from Cochlear Implant recipients on a new Sound Processor System

Description
Inclusion Criteria:
- 12 months old or older
- Implanted with a CI24RE (Freedom implant) or later implant in at least one implanted ear
- Use of the CP810, CP920 or CP910 sound processor
- Willingness to participate in and to comply with all requirements of the protocol
Exclusion Criteria:
- Unrealistic expectations on the part of the subject, regarding the possible benefits, risks and limitations that are inherent to the procedure and prosthetic device
- Additional disabilities or illnesses that would prevent participation in evaluations or compromise the integrity of the investigation or quality of data collected
- Nucleus 22 or Nucleus 24 Implant in ear to be fitted with the investigational device
